Whether playing the cello, trombone, laptop or all three, Dana Leong breaks all boundaries by mixing jazz with funk with hip-hop and electronica. His influence comes from urban music, pop, rock but also orchestral music and jazz and has been described as innovative and sublime.He is currently the Jazz ambassador for Lincoln Center and the US State Department recently traveling to Southeast Asia on a cultural exchange with his quartet, Milk & Jade. He's worked with some of the greatest artists in history - Paquito D'Rivera, Ray Charles, Kanye West, and Wynton Marsalis. His new album is Anthems of Life. Less
